Graphwick dependency visualizer: plugin render calls are failing with 403 since Monday. Cause: the shared plugin credential expired. External authors should swap it in their manifest and re-register; no other changes needed. Node and edge APIs are unaffected once auth succeeds. The replacement key for the internal render service follows.

API key for tagug-tajef: vxb4-R1fo

Subject: Cold storage archive cutover next week

Hi folks — quick note before Thursday's release. We're archiving the Larkspur cold storage buckets older than 18 months, and your integration will need to switch reads over to the archive gateway. Nothing changes in the payload shape, just the base path and auth. Objects stay retrievable, only slower. For the dry run against the archive gateway, authenticate your requests using the bearer token below.

portal login ticket: eyJhbGciOiJIUzI1NiIsInR5cCI6IkpXVCJ9.eyJzdWIiOiIwEOsktwVNwIn0.-UJU3fdyyCgG

**Ticket: Config drift on BounceSift processor**

The email bounce processor in the Larkfield environment has drifted from the values committed in the release branch. Retry windows and suppression thresholds no longer match, which likely explains the duplicate suppression entries reported Tuesday. Please reconcile before the Thursday cut. For reference, the currently deployed configuration on the live node reads as follows.

config for yajep-yahof:
[briax]
port = 9200
region = outer-2
host = briax.nelvrocorp.test
team = raleth
timeout_ms = 1500
retries = 1

**Runbook: Pixelvault image cache leak**

Since the 4.2 rollout, the Pixelvault thumbnail cache on the render tier has been leaking roughly 300 MB per hour because evicted entries keep a reference in the resize queue. Mitigation is a rolling restart of the cache pods every six hours until Marden's fix lands. To verify eviction counts, query the cache_metrics table directly on the staging replica. Use the following connection string for that check.

replica DSN, kajep-yahag: mssql://praok_svc:iF@db-8d68.plorvaio.local:5432/eliion